For all qualifications except Cambridge Primary Checkpoint and Cambridge Checkpoint, you will receive the following documents in hard copy after the release of provisional results online:
- Results by syllabus, option and component for teaching staff.
- Moderation adjustment summary reports for teaching staff (where applicable): a summary of moderation adjustments for every internally assessed component.
- Moderation report for teaching staff (where applicable): a report on the moderation for each internally assessed component.

Changes to the Cambridge provisional results despatch (from June 2015 - UK)
If your school is in the UK, your provisional results despatch will not include hard copy Statements of Results and results broadsheets. You can download Statements of Results and results broadsheets from the Direct homepage or from your MIS package when results are released online.
Six weeks after results release, Statements of Results and results broadsheets will be removed from the Direct homepage. To access them you will need to log into your Cambridge International Direct account, visit the ‘Administer Exams’ section and click on the ‘File Transfers’ tab.
The explanatory notes showing what the qualification and syllabus grades means will not appear on electronic Statements of Results. You can download the explanatory notes as a separate document from the ‘Support Materials’ section of Direct.
